Basic Information

scroll
 AreaApproximately 2,400 square kilometers
PopulationApproximately 820,000
Prefectural capitalSaga City

Arita Town: A Place to Discover the Charm of Arita Pottery

Arita Town is famous for its ceramics, and its beautiful pottery studios and pottery-making experiences provide visitors with much to look forward to. Arita-yaki is an important part of the history of ceramics in Japan, and here visitors can find wonderful ceramics while experiencing its history.

A tour of the Arita-yaki pottery kilns is especially recommended. There are many kilns scattered throughout the town, where potters create their own unique pieces. A visit to one of the kilns will give you the opportunity to observe the pottery making process, and you will be impressed by how the work is created. You can also purchase beautiful ceramics for souvenirs.

Karatsu City: History and Coastal Beauty

Karatsu Castle Ruins is a fascinating spot for history lovers. The castle ruins offer a panoramic view of the beautiful Karatsu coastline, especially at sunset. The castle also houses a history museum, where visitors can learn about the construction of the castle and the excitement of the Warring States period, in addition to getting a taste of history.

Many cherry trees are planted around the castle ruins, attracting visitors during the cherry blossom season. If you visit Karatsu Castle Ruins during the cherry blossom season, you can enjoy both history and the beauty of nature at the same time.

Imari City: Enjoying Ceramics and Beautiful Beaches

Imari City is also known as the town of Imari Pottery, and there are plenty of workshops where visitors can learn the traditional techniques of pottery making. For pottery enthusiasts, this is the perfect place to experience the joy of making pottery on their own. Try your hand at creating your own piece while learning the process of pottery making.

There are also beautiful beaches along Imari Bay, where you can enjoy walking and swimming on the shore. It is a place where the beautiful natural environment and the world of art are combined into one.

Takeo City: Healing Nature and Hot Springs

Takeo Onsen is a treasure trove of beautiful natural scenery and hot springs. It is perfect for those who want to relax and is known as a hot spring for beautiful skin. Takeo Shimin-no Mori, a forest beloved by the locals, offers visitors the opportunity to enjoy forest bathing. Visitors can also enjoy interacting with a variety of animals at the Takeo Forest Zoo.

Takeo City is not only a hot spring resort, but also offers an abundance of fun spots for nature lovers and families. It is the perfect place to get away from the hustle and bustle of daily life and seek nature and healing.

Saga City: A City of History and Gastronomy

Saga Castle, the symbol of Saga City, is a bustling cherry blossom viewing spot during the beautiful cherry blossom season. Inside the castle there are historical buildings and a museum where visitors can learn about Saga’s history. The view from the castle ruins is also spectacular, allowing visitors to enjoy the city and the surrounding landscape.

Saga City is also famous for its premium Wagyu beef, known as Saga Beef. Tasting Saga beef shabushabu or steak at a local restaurant is an absolute must for gourmets. Enjoy the fresh local produce and enjoy all that Saga has to offer!
